Coolant, Mixing
It is extremely important that the system is filled with
the correct coolant concentration; refer to Technical
Data, page 132.
The coolant should be mixed with distilled, deionized
water. For Bukh specified water requirements; refer
to Technical Data, page 132.
NOTICE! If water quality can not be guaranteed, use
ready mixed coolant.
Coolant Level, Checking and
Topping Up
WARNING!
Do not open the coolant filler cap when the engine is
hot, except
in emergencies as this could cause serious
personal injury. Steam or hot fluid could spray out.
1 Turn the filler cover slowly counter-clockwise and
release any pressure from the system before
removing the cover completely.
2 Top the coolant up as necessary. The coolant level
shall be between the MAX and MIN marks on the
expansion tank.
3 Screw the filler cover on.
Seawater System
The raw water system is the engine's external cooling
system. On engines with drives, the raw water pump
sucks in water via the drive, through the control
system's oil cooler to the raw water pump. The water
then passes through the raw water filter before being
pumped through the fuel cooler, intercooler, engine oil
cooler and heat exchanger. Finally the water is fed out
through the exhaust elbow, where it is mixed with the
exhaust gases.
On engines with reverse gears, the raw water pump
sucks in water via a raw water intake, after which the
water passes a raw water filter (extra equipment)
before being pumped through the intercooler, heat
exchanger, engine oil cooler and gearbox oil cooler.
Finally the water is fed out through the exhaust elbow,
where it is mixed with the exhaust gases.
